SP1 antibody LS-B6148 is an unconjugated mouse monoclonal antibody to SP1 from human. It is reactive with human and mouse. Validated for ELISA, IF, IHC and WB. Tested on 20 paraffin-embedded human tissues. Cited in 1 publication.
